Monica Monte: "Outex adapts to me instead of my having to adapt to the gear."
I think of myself as a storyteller. And in order to tell each story in the best way, that means I have to get as close as possible to where the story happens. So when I shoot a water-related story, I want to get my head wet to get as near as possible to the action. I'm thrilled I discovered Outex waterproof camera gear, which allows me to act the same way as I do on land. It feels natural to paddle out with my camera, I can still feel all my dial buttons, I can make the images that I have in mind. I get to decide at the very last moment which body and what lenses I want to use before I head into the water and I almost always have a kit in my travel luggage, just in case and because it is so light. Outex is the gear that adapts to me, instead of me having to adapt to my gear.
